Gsd No B-11 (Gc 3) is a flood risk reduction dam located in Muscotah, Kansas along the Little Grasshopper Creek-TR. Built in 1987 by the USDA NRCS, this earth dam stands at a height of 32.5 feet and has a storage capacity of 295 acre-feet. With a primary purpose of flood risk reduction, the dam also serves for debris control in the area, providing essential protection to the community.
Managed by the Kansas Department of Agriculture, Gsd No B-11 (Gc 3) is regulated, permitted, inspected, and enforced by state agencies to ensure its safe operation and maintenance. The dam has a low hazard potential and is categorized as having a moderate risk assessment level. Although the condition assessment is currently not rated, the dam meets guidelines for emergency action plans and risk management measures are in place to mitigate potential risks.
Located in Atchison County, Kansas, Gsd No B-11 (Gc 3) plays a vital role in safeguarding the surrounding area from flooding events.
